With the changes introduced here, early_radix_enabled() becomes usable and will be used in arch_reserve_crashkernel() in the upcoming patch. early_radix_enabled() depends on cur_cpu_spec->mmu_features to find out if the radix MMU is enabled. The radix MMU bit in mmu_features is discovered from the FDT and kernel configs. To make sure the MMU type is finalized before arch_reserve_crashkernel() is called, the function that scans the FDT and sets mmu_features, along with some bits from mmu_early_type_finalize(), has been moved above arch_reserve_crashkernel().
